Redis所有的數(shù)據(jù)都存在內(nèi)存中淫半, 當(dāng)前內(nèi)存雖然越來越便宜奠旺, 但跟廉價的硬盤相比成本還是比較昂貴劣砍, 因此如何高效利用Redis內(nèi)存變得非常重要对粪。 高效利用Redis內(nèi)存首先需...

Redis所有的數(shù)據(jù)都存在內(nèi)存中淫半, 當(dāng)前內(nèi)存雖然越來越便宜奠旺, 但跟廉價的硬盤相比成本還是比較昂貴劣砍, 因此如何高效利用Redis內(nèi)存變得非常重要对粪。 高效利用Redis內(nèi)存首先需...
為了避免Linux系統(tǒng)的主機(jī),在長時間運(yùn)行下所導(dǎo)致的時間偏差薇芝。因此我們需要對時間進(jìn)行時間同步(synchronize)蓬抄。我們一般使用ntp服務(wù)來同步不同機(jī)器的時間。NTP 是...
消息隊(duì)列在互聯(lián)網(wǎng)技術(shù)存儲方面使用如此廣泛,幾乎所有的后端技術(shù)面試官都要在消息隊(duì)列的使用和原理方面對小伙伴們進(jìn)行360°的刁難荐开。 面試官杠上消息隊(duì)列付翁?重復(fù)消費(fèi)、消息堆積晃听、消息丟...
有幾個問題想問下博主:
1.epoch這邊leader是有持久化佣渴,放在一個文件上的辫狼,那么follower上有持久化嗎?我看博主上面說的是緩存辛润,broker宕機(jī)了就沒了吧
2.min.insync.replicas=1膨处,一旦leader寫成功就認(rèn)為已提交,那么follower在fetch最新消息的時候砂竖,還沒拉取到真椿,這個時候leader掛了,follower成為了新leader乎澄,這個時候新leader沒有這個“已提交”數(shù)據(jù)突硝,不就丟失了嗎?這個和hw三圆、epoch機(jī)制都沒啥關(guān)系吧
前言 上一篇文章解析了Raft協(xié)議的選舉機(jī)制狞换,客戶端通過和選舉出來的Leader通信來讀寫數(shù)據(jù)【傳送門[http://www.reibang.com/p/7a313173b...
前言 Raft協(xié)議是現(xiàn)在使用最廣泛的分布式一致性協(xié)議,這篇文章的本意不是翻譯它的協(xié)議內(nèi)容(已經(jīng)有大神做過了查库,中文版Raft協(xié)議[https://github.com/maem...
前言 前兩篇文章分別解析了Raft中領(lǐng)導(dǎo)人選舉和日志復(fù)制規(guī)范路媚,對于一個固定的集群來說,有了這些規(guī)范的保護(hù)樊销,就可以快樂的一致運(yùn)行下去了整慎。隨著業(yè)務(wù)的變化,總歸會出現(xiàn)集群規(guī)模變更的...
點(diǎn)贊再看剂府,養(yǎng)成習(xí)慣拧揽,微信搜索【牧小農(nóng)】關(guān)注我獲取更多資訊,風(fēng)里雨里腺占,小農(nóng)等你淤袜,很高興能夠成為你的朋友。 什么是Kubernetes衰伯? Kubernetes 是Google開源...
查看原文獲得更好閱讀體驗(yàn)烦周。 剛開始接觸K8s的同學(xué)可能都會覺得有一定的學(xué)習(xí)難度尽爆,撲面而來的各種概念到底是什么。比如读慎,如何提供一個服務(wù)給別人漱贱,我是應(yīng)該用Pod還是用Deploy...
條件變量 條件變量的引入是為了解決互斥鎖中的循環(huán)等待問題闰靴,其希望引入一種掛起彪笼、喚醒的機(jī)制來實(shí)現(xiàn)cpu的高效利用使用條件變量解決生產(chǎn)者消費(fèi)者問題: 條件變量的實(shí)現(xiàn)中要注意,當(dāng)線...
前言 如果說php是最好的語言蚂且,那么golang就是最并發(fā)的語言配猫。支持golang的并發(fā)很重要的一個是goroutine的實(shí)現(xiàn),那么本文將重點(diǎn)圍繞goroutine來做一下相...
本文主要介紹go中init函數(shù)的使用及意義杏死。 I泵肄、init的幾個特征 1、init函數(shù)用于包的初始化淑翼,如初始化包中的變量腐巢,這個初始化在package xxx的時候完成,也就是...
WebSocket在 HTML5 游戲和網(wǎng)頁消息推送都使用比較多遭京。WebSocket 是 HTML5 的重要特性胃惜,它實(shí)現(xiàn)了基于瀏覽器的遠(yuǎn)程socket,它使瀏覽器和服務(wù)器可以...
Kafka中的每個partition都由一系列有序的哪雕、不可變的消息組成船殉,這些消息被連續(xù)的追加到partition中。partition中的每個消息都有一個連續(xù)的序號斯嚎,用于pa...